Output 81ea96fa43275e3aec32fd86be5ff2abc8a13cf05469ece7602d0ae3ad6bf963:4

value
2691
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b046a5259f0965f68391ba63c49ab9c6eaa2346e48781dd8d52c9c39e8e87dd1
address
bc1pkpr22fvlp9jldqu3hf3ufx4ecm42ydrwfpupmkx49jwrn68g0hgs7fxpal
transaction
81ea96fa43275e3aec32fd86be5ff2abc8a13cf05469ece7602d0ae3ad6bf963
spent
true